Abstract (EN)

In this study, metal organic frameworks were synthesized with hyrothermal/ solvothermal method and ionothermal assisted by ultrasonic method. Then their usage as adsorbent and catalyst were studied. In adsorption experiments, aromatic organic compounds including toluene and nitrobenzene and dyes such as methyl orange and methyl red adsorption experiments were investigated. The effects of the parameters such as initial concentration, contact time, adsorbent dosage, and temperature on the adsorption capacity were investigated for the determination of the best fit adsorption isotherm, adsorption kinetics, adsorption thermodynamics, and equilibrium time. In esterification part of the study, chemically stable MOF structures were sulfonated and used as catalyst in esterification reactions of acetic acid. With using metal organic frameworks as catalysts, high conversions were obtained in the production of esters which are among the most important chemical products. In esterification reaction, the effects of different parameters such as alcohol, temperature, sulfonation, reusability, catalyst loading, alcohol to acid molar ratio were investigated. And experiments without catalyst were also carried out to elaborate the performance of the catalyst.
